Output 406ea3134096778b9558c35c59a1f72ca72141acb88f043ef92c4abbaae4c0e7:0

value
76185392
script pubkey
OP_0 OP_PUSHBYTES_20 ab318e8afb5ed90682e8ad387399549261092d7a
address
bc1q4vccazhmtmvsdqhg45u88x25jfssjtt6qt2pay
transaction
406ea3134096778b9558c35c59a1f72ca72141acb88f043ef92c4abbaae4c0e7
spent
true